महानतम सामान्य अनुवर्ती
Problem
दिए गए दो अनुक्रमों के लिए, आपको उनके सबसे लंबे सामान्य अनुक्रम की लंबाई ज्ञात करने की आवश्यकता है।
इनपुट
इनपुट की पहली पंक्ति में संख्या N – पहले क्रम की लंबाई (1 ≤ N ≤ 1000)। दूसरी पंक्ति में पहले अनुक्रम के सदस्य शामिल हैं (एक स्थान द्वारा अलग किए गए) – पूर्णांक 10000 मॉड्यूल से अधिक नहीं।
तीसरी पंक्ति में संख्या M – दूसरे क्रम की लंबाई (1 ≤ M ≤ 1000)। चौथी पंक्ति में दूसरे अनुक्रम के सदस्य शामिल हैं (एक स्थान द्वारा अलग किए गए) – पूर्णांक 10000 मॉड्यूल से अधिक नहीं।
आउटपुट
एक संख्या को आउटपुट करने के लिए आवश्यक है – लम्बाई दिए गए दो अनुक्रमों का सबसे बड़ा सामान्य क्रम, या 0 अगर ऐसा कोई क्रम नहीं है।
<तालिका सीमा = "1" सेलपैडिंग = "1" सेलस्पेसिंग = "1" शैली = "चौड़ाई: 500 पीएक्स">
<शरीर>
इनपुट |
आउटपुट |
<टीडी>
3
1 2 3
3
2 3 1
टीडी>
2 |
टेबल>